For the LORD is good; his steadfast love endures forever, and his faithfulness to all generations.
PSALM 100:5 · ESV

"To all generations" is a strange thing to claim about anything. Most goodness we experience is local and temporary — a kind stranger, a lucky break, a season that eventually turns. This verse is claiming something that doesn't depend on the century, the culture, or the particular mess any given generation makes of things. The faithfulness described here has apparently outlasted every failure of every generation that's ever tried to test it.

That's either an exaggeration or the most stable thing anyone could ever stand on. And it's worth noticing this isn't a claim about how good people have been — it's a claim about how consistent God has been despite that.

You're one generation in a very long line of people who've wondered if this kind of goodness could really hold up. It's a fair question. But it's one worth actually investigating rather than assuming the answer.
